How are translation memories (TMs) used to identify and apply content variants in DITA?

Translation memories (TMs) play a valuable role in identifying and applying content variants in DITA XML, streamlining the translation process and ensuring consistency across multiple language versions. TMs are databases that store previously translated content, and they can be leveraged to improve the efficiency and accuracy of translating content variants.

Identifying Matching Segments

When translating DITA content, TMs are used to identify segments of text that have been previously translated. These segments can include entire sentences, paragraphs, or even individual terms. By matching the content to the translation memory, translators can quickly identify existing translations for content variants, reducing the need for redundant translation efforts.

Translation Memory Example:

Here’s an example of how translation memories can be applied to DITA content variants:


<topic id="product_description">
  <title>Product Description</title>
  <body>
    <p>This is the product description for the general audience.</p>
    <p>This content segment may have been previously translated into multiple languages and stored in the translation memory.</p>
  </body>

In this example, the translation memory can store and retrieve the translation for the common content segment, reducing the translation effort for content variants.

Ensuring Consistency

By utilizing translation memories, DITA content variants can maintain consistency across languages and audiences. Translators can reference previous translations, ensuring that terminology and style remain uniform, even for distinct content variants. This not only saves time and effort but also enhances the overall quality of multilingual documentation.